Bob Mintzer, grammy award winning saxophonist with the Yellowjackets says, "Kelly Eisenhour is a wonderful vocalist who can really spin a tale. The arrangements and choice of material on her (recent) cd are really great. I was inspired and challenged by this music. I truly enjoyed playing on her recording and will look foward to watching Kelly's rise to the recognition level she deserves."

Keith Lockhart, conductor of the Boston Pops says, "Kelly's such a great performer, it's truly a pleasure to share a stage with her. Great sound, great approach to the music, really versatile. ....she's the real thing."
